Advanced Google Sheets Formulas You Need to Know
Unlock the entire potential with your Google Sheets skills by mastering some sophisticated formulas. Beyond elementary SUM and AVERAGE, consider delving through functions like INDEX/MATCH for adaptable lookups, ARRAYFORMULA to simplify calculations across multiple rows or columns, and QUERY for pulling specific data. Furthermore, explore a nuances related to functions like VLOOKUP/HLOOKUP, DATE/TIME functions, and even begin to comprehend conditional logic with IF and nested IF statements – it's the game-changer for data management and analysis.

Google Sheets vs. Excel : Which Spreadsheet is Suitable for You ?
Choosing compared to Google Sheets and Excel can be tricky, as both give powerful spreadsheet read more capabilities. Google Sheets truly excels with its web-based nature, allowing for easy collaboration and access from anywhere . This makes it especially beneficial for businesses that require shared modification . Conversely, Excel stays a powerful force, particularly for individuals needing advanced features like in-depth formulas, powerful charting options, and offline functionality . Consider your specific needs - if shared access is critical , Google Sheets probably be the better fit. If you’re considerable calculations features and local work , Excel might be the way path .
